Swartland Shiraz from this region typically displays rich blackberry and plum fruit, white pepper spice, hints of dark chocolate and smoky tones, with a full body and well-integrated tannins leading to a lingering finish.
Swartland is a large wine-producing area approximately 65 kilometres north of Cape Town, traditionally known for wheat farming but now celebrated for rich, fruit-driven wines from Shiraz, Chenin Blanc, and Grenache, with many producers championing dry-farmed old bush vines and minimal-intervention winemaking. The region has gained international acclaim for its bold, terroir-expressive style and is considered one of South Africa's most exciting and innovative wine regions.
